1. Question
Upon reviewing a critically injured patient who has sustained blunt abdominal trauma following a motor vehicle accident, presenting with hypotension, tachycardia, and abdominal distension, what is the most appropriate initial management strategy to ensure optimal patient outcomes?
Correct
This scenario presents a significant professional challenge due to the immediate, life-threatening nature of the patient’s condition, the complexity of managing multi-system trauma in a critical care setting, and the imperative to adhere to established resuscitation protocols under extreme pressure. The need for rapid, accurate assessment and intervention, coupled with the potential for rapid deterioration, demands a systematic and evidence-based approach. Careful judgment is required to prioritize interventions, delegate tasks effectively, and ensure seamless communication within the multidisciplinary team, all while maintaining patient safety and dignity. The correct approach involves immediate, systematic ABCDE assessment and management, prioritizing airway, breathing, circulation, disability, and exposure. This aligns with universally accepted trauma resuscitation guidelines, such as those promoted by the Advanced Trauma Life Support (ATLS) program, which are foundational in pan-regional critical care. This structured approach ensures that the most immediately life-threatening issues are addressed first, preventing secondary injury and optimizing the patient’s physiological status for further management. Adherence to these protocols is ethically mandated to provide the highest standard of care and is a cornerstone of professional practice in emergency medicine and critical care. An incorrect approach would be to focus solely on the obvious abdominal injury without a comprehensive systemic assessment. This failure to systematically address airway, breathing, and circulation could lead to preventable hypoxemia, hypovolemic shock, or neurological compromise, exacerbating the patient’s overall condition and potentially leading to irreversible organ damage or death. Ethically, this represents a deviation from the duty of care to provide comprehensive and timely management. Another incorrect approach would be to delay definitive surgical intervention in favor of extensive, non-emergent diagnostic imaging before initial resuscitation is complete. While imaging is crucial, delaying life-saving measures like fluid resuscitation, blood transfusion, or airway management for prolonged imaging studies in a hemodynamically unstable patient is contrary to established resuscitation principles. This could lead to further physiological derangement and is ethically questionable due to the potential for avoidable harm. A further incorrect approach would be to proceed with surgery without adequate fluid resuscitation and correction of coagulopathy. While the patient clearly requires surgical intervention for the abdominal trauma, proceeding without addressing critical physiological derangements significantly increases operative risk, including uncontrolled hemorrhage and poor surgical outcomes. This neglects the fundamental principle of stabilizing the patient to the greatest extent possible before undertaking major operative procedures. Professional decision-making in such situations should be guided by a hierarchical framework: first, ensure scene safety and personal protection; second, rapidly assess and manage life threats using the ABCDE approach; third, initiate appropriate resuscitation measures (fluids, blood products, oxygen); fourth, conduct a focused history and physical examination; fifth, order necessary investigations and imaging; and finally, plan definitive management, including surgical intervention, in a timely and coordinated manner. Continuous reassessment and adaptation of the management plan based on the patient’s response are paramount.

3. Question
The analysis reveals a patient presenting with symptoms suggestive of a complex hepatopancreatobiliary pathology in a setting with limited access to advanced diagnostic imaging. The patient speaks a language not understood by the surgical team, and their immediate family is present. The surgeon suspects the condition may require significant surgical intervention. What is the most appropriate course of action?
Correct
Scenario Analysis: This scenario presents a significant professional challenge due to the inherent complexity of hepatopancreatobiliary (HPB) surgery, the potential for severe post-operative complications, and the critical need for timely and accurate diagnosis in a resource-limited setting. The surgeon must balance the urgency of the patient’s condition with the ethical imperative to obtain informed consent and ensure the patient’s understanding of the risks and benefits, especially when dealing with a language barrier. The lack of immediate access to advanced diagnostic imaging further complicates the decision-making process, requiring reliance on clinical acumen and potentially less definitive investigations. Careful judgment is required to navigate these factors and ensure the patient receives appropriate and ethically sound care. Correct Approach Analysis: The best professional practice involves proceeding with a thorough pre-operative assessment, including a detailed clinical examination and history, followed by a discussion with the patient regarding the suspected diagnosis, the proposed surgical intervention, its potential benefits, and significant risks. Crucially, this discussion must be conducted with the aid of a qualified medical interpreter to overcome the language barrier and ensure genuine informed consent. If a definitive diagnosis cannot be established pre-operatively due to resource limitations, the surgeon should explain this to the patient and outline the plan for intra-operative assessment and management, including the possibility of staging the surgery or performing a less extensive procedure if indicated. This approach prioritizes patient autonomy, safety, and ethical medical practice by ensuring comprehension and consent, even in challenging circumstances. Incorrect Approaches Analysis: Proceeding with surgery without ensuring the patient fully understands the procedure, risks, and benefits due to a language barrier is a significant ethical failure. It violates the principle of informed consent, potentially leading to patient dissatisfaction and legal repercussions. Relying solely on a family member to interpret can introduce bias and may not guarantee accurate medical translation of complex surgical concepts. Delaying surgery indefinitely until advanced imaging is available, without considering the patient’s clinical deterioration, is professionally unacceptable. While imaging is valuable, it should not supersede the need for timely intervention when clinically indicated, especially in a potentially life-threatening condition. This approach fails to adequately address the patient’s immediate medical needs. Performing a more extensive and potentially riskier surgery than initially contemplated without explicit discussion and consent from the patient, even if the surgeon suspects a more severe condition intra-operatively, is a violation of patient autonomy and ethical surgical practice. While intra-operative findings can necessitate changes, these should ideally be discussed with the patient or their surrogate if feasible, or the procedure should be limited to what was consented for, with a plan for subsequent management. Professional Reasoning: Professionals facing similar situations should employ a structured decision-making process. First, assess the clinical urgency and potential risks of delay versus intervention. Second, identify and address any communication barriers, prioritizing the use of qualified medical interpreters for informed consent. Third, consider available resources and their limitations, making pragmatic decisions based on clinical judgment and ethical principles. Fourth, document all discussions, decisions, and rationale thoroughly. Finally, consult with colleagues or ethics committees when faced with complex ethical dilemmas.

7. Question
Benchmark analysis indicates that a patient presenting for complex hepatopancreatobiliary surgery has severe cardiac dysfunction and a significant coagulopathy. Which structured operative planning approach best mitigates the risks associated with these comorbidities?
Correct
Scenario Analysis: This scenario presents a professionally challenging situation due to the inherent complexity and potential for significant patient harm in advanced hepatopancreatobiliary surgery. The patient’s comorbidities (severe cardiac dysfunction and coagulopathy) introduce substantial perioperative risk, demanding meticulous pre-operative assessment and a robust, adaptable operative plan. The challenge lies in balancing the necessity of surgical intervention with the patient’s fragile physiological state, requiring a multidisciplinary approach and a clear strategy for risk mitigation. Failure to adequately address these risks can lead to catastrophic outcomes, including intraoperative hemorrhage, cardiac events, prolonged recovery, and increased morbidity and mortality. Correct Approach Analysis: The best professional practice involves a comprehensive, structured operative plan that explicitly addresses the identified risks and outlines specific mitigation strategies. This approach necessitates a pre-operative multidisciplinary team meeting involving surgeons, anesthesiologists, cardiologists, hematologists, and critical care specialists. During this meeting, a detailed review of the patient’s cardiac status and coagulopathy will occur, leading to the development of tailored anesthetic management, intraoperative hemodynamic monitoring, and transfusion protocols. The surgical plan will include contingency measures for potential bleeding, such as readily available blood products, specific surgical techniques to minimize blood loss, and clear decision-making algorithms for intraoperative management of coagulopathy. Post-operative care will be meticulously planned, including intensive care unit (ICU) admission and specific monitoring parameters. This structured, collaborative approach aligns with the ethical principles of beneficence and non-maleficence, ensuring that all potential risks are proactively identified and managed to optimize patient safety and outcomes. It also reflects best practice guidelines for complex surgical procedures, emphasizing a team-based approach to patient care. Incorrect Approaches Analysis: Proceeding with surgery without a formal, documented multidisciplinary risk assessment and mitigation plan is professionally unacceptable. This approach fails to adequately address the patient’s significant comorbidities, potentially leading to unforeseen complications during the procedure. The absence of a structured plan for managing cardiac instability or coagulopathy increases the likelihood of adverse events, such as uncontrolled bleeding or a cardiac arrest, directly violating the principle of non-maleficence. Relying solely on the surgeon’s experience and intuition without explicit pre-operative planning for the identified risks is also professionally deficient. While experience is valuable, it cannot substitute for a systematic evaluation and documented strategy for managing specific patient vulnerabilities. This approach risks overlooking critical details or failing to adequately prepare for potential complications, thereby compromising patient safety. Focusing exclusively on the technical aspects of the surgical procedure while downplaying the impact of the patient’s comorbidities demonstrates a failure to adopt a holistic patient-centered approach. The patient’s overall physiological status is intrinsically linked to surgical success. Neglecting to integrate the management of cardiac dysfunction and coagulopathy into the operative plan creates a significant vulnerability that could lead to severe perioperative complications. Professional Reasoning: Professionals in advanced surgical practice must adopt a systematic, risk-stratified approach to operative planning. This involves: 1) Thorough pre-operative assessment, identifying all patient-specific risks and comorbidities. 2) Engaging a multidisciplinary team to comprehensively evaluate these risks and contribute to the planning process. 3) Developing a detailed, documented operative plan that includes specific strategies for risk mitigation, contingency measures, and clear decision-making pathways for intraoperative and post-operative management. 4) Ensuring clear communication and consensus among all team members regarding the plan. This framework ensures that patient safety is paramount and that interventions are tailored to individual patient needs, thereby upholding the highest standards of professional conduct and ethical practice.

9. Question
Quality control measures reveal that a patient presenting for advanced hepatopancreatobiliary surgery has fluctuating cognitive function, making their capacity to provide informed consent uncertain. The patient has a designated healthcare surrogate. What is the most appropriate course of action for the surgical team?
Correct
This scenario presents a professional challenge due to the inherent conflict between patient autonomy, the need for timely and effective treatment, and the surgeon’s ethical and professional obligations to ensure informed consent and maintain patient trust. The complexity arises from the patient’s diminished capacity to fully comprehend the risks and benefits of a major surgical intervention, necessitating a careful balancing act to protect the patient’s best interests while respecting their residual autonomy. The best professional approach involves a multi-faceted strategy that prioritizes comprehensive assessment of the patient’s capacity, engagement with the patient’s designated surrogate decision-maker, and thorough documentation of all discussions and decisions. This approach aligns with established ethical principles of beneficence, non-maleficence, and respect for autonomy, as well as regulatory requirements for informed consent. Specifically, it requires a formal assessment of the patient’s decision-making capacity by a qualified professional, followed by a detailed discussion of the proposed surgery, its alternatives, risks, and benefits with both the patient (to the extent of their capacity) and their surrogate. Obtaining consent from the surrogate, after ensuring they understand their role and the patient’s known wishes or best interests, is paramount. This process ensures that the patient’s rights are upheld, even when their capacity is compromised, and that the surgical team acts within legal and ethical boundaries. An approach that proceeds with surgery based solely on the surrogate’s immediate agreement without a formal capacity assessment is professionally unacceptable. This fails to adequately protect the patient’s autonomy and may violate regulatory requirements for informed consent, which mandate a reasonable understanding of the procedure. It also risks overlooking potential nuances in the patient’s own preferences or values that the surrogate might not be fully aware of. Another professionally unacceptable approach is to delay surgery indefinitely due to the patient’s fluctuating capacity, without exploring all avenues for obtaining valid consent or making a timely decision in the patient’s best interest. This could lead to patient harm if the condition is progressive and requires prompt intervention, potentially violating the principle of beneficence. Finally, proceeding with surgery based on a presumed best interest without any consultation with a surrogate or documented attempt to assess capacity is ethically and legally indefensible. This disregards the patient’s right to have their wishes considered and their interests represented by a trusted individual, and it fails to meet the standard of care for obtaining consent in complex situations. Professionals should employ a structured decision-making process that begins with assessing the patient’s capacity to consent. If capacity is questionable or absent, the next step is to identify and engage the appropriate surrogate decision-maker. All discussions, assessments, and decisions must be meticulously documented. If there is any doubt or conflict, seeking guidance from ethics committees or legal counsel is advisable.
